Understanding Sweden's Driving License System Sweden operates under a comprehensive traffic system that prioritizes safety and standardized screening. The Swedish Transport Administration, called Transportstyrelsen, oversees all licensing matters, while approved driving schools and evaluation centers deal with the practical elements of training and screening. The system differentiates between different license classifications, with the B-category license being the most common for guest automobiles.
For foreigners residing in Sweden, the path to acquiring a license depends mostly on your native land. The Swedish federal government has actually established various procedures for citizens from European Union and European Economic Area countries compared to those from non-EU/EEA nations. This distinction exists since Sweden has shared recognition contracts with EU and EEA member states, while licenses from outside this region need extra verification and sometimes extra testing.
Driving with a Foreign License in Sweden If you hold a valid driving license from another country, you might have the ability to use it in Sweden for a specific duration without exchanging it. EU and EEA license holders can utilize their existing licenses forever while living in Sweden, however lots of pick to exchange them for Swedish licenses for convenience. People of countries with which Sweden has a mutual agreement can normally use their foreign licenses for up to one year after developing residency, after which they should obtain a Swedish license.

Converting an EU or EEA License Foreigners holding driving licenses from EU or EEA nations take advantage of a relatively straightforward conversion procedure. Sweden acknowledges these licenses as fully legitimate, meaning holders do not require to take theoretical or useful driving tests. The process is primarily administrative, needing candidates to submit their foreign license for verification and exchange.
To convert your EU or EEA license, you must visit your local transport workplace, known as a Trafikverkets kontor, with specific documents. This includes your original passport or national identity card, your current driving license, and proof of your Swedish house address. There is a small administrative fee for the exchange, and you will require to provide a photo for the new license. The processing time usually ranges from one to three weeks, after which you will get a Swedish-issued license card that complies with EU requirements.

The theoretical test, called the kunskapsprov, examines your understanding of traffic guidelines, road indications, automobile maintenance, and safe driving practices. This computer-based test consists of multiple-choice concerns and is offered in numerous languages, though taking it in Swedish or English is recommended since these are the most commonly used languages during actual traffic circumstances.
The practical driving test, the körprov, evaluates your capability to run an automobile securely in real traffic conditions. An examiner accompanies you through numerous driving situations, including urban driving, highway merging, parking maneuvers, and emergency situations. The test normally lasts in between 30 and 45 minutes and includes a lorry safety evaluation part where you need to show knowledge of important vehicle upkeep and security checks.
The majority of foreigners find the Swedish testing system to be fair but extensive. The theoretical test requires genuine understanding rather than basic memorization, while the practical test emphasizes protective driving strategies and adaptive behavior to altering road conditions. Taking preparatory courses at a recognized driving school substantially increases your possibilities of success on the very first attempt.
Needed Documentation and Eligibility Despite your origin, a number of universal requirements apply to all candidates for Swedish driving licenses. You need to be at least 18 years of age for a basic B-category license and need to have lawfully lived in Sweden for a minimum duration, normally six months, before applying. A valid Swedish house license or personal number is essential, as theTransportstyrelsen requires this for identity verification and record-keeping.
Medical physical fitness is another requirement. All license applicants must complete a medical checkup verifying they satisfy Swedish health requirements for safe driving. This examination can be carried out through an authorized physician or occupational health service. Conditions that might impact driving ability must be assessed, though many common health issues do not disqualify applicants offered they are effectively handled.
